Transaction 358327074edb262ccbd971f755c6961cc5654b96b7ce55da9e5b607327b95b8c
1 Input
1 Output
-
358327074edb262ccbd971f755c6961cc5654b96b7ce55da9e5b607327b95b8c:0
- value
- 34236958
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 22e2f2768f65384a3b161252f96c55603c5918ab OP_EQUAL
- address
- MB5d5WpHFQvAemCAB4dy1Ri4RuqRRK4QEW